520 ## - SUMMARY, ETC.
Summary, etc. Yield and water-use efficiency ofsquash (Cucurbita pepo L.) under drip<br/>deficit irrigation and mulching were investigated Field experiments were<br/>conducted for two consecutive seasons (summer and fall), to study the<br/>effect of different mulches (without mulch, WM as a control, white<br/>polyethylene: PM, rice straw: RSM, farmyard manure: FYMj on growth,<br/>water-use efficiency (WUE) and yield of squash under three irrigation<br/>treatments. Amount of applied irrigation to each experimental plot<br/>depended upon a percentage ofETc computed using the equation ofAllen<br/>et al (1998) in addition to the leaching requirements and considering the<br/>irrigation application efficiency. Irrigation treatments were irrigation on<br/>basis of 100, 85 and 70 % of computed evapotranspiration. Plant<br/>photosynthesis efficiency, total soluble sugars (FSS), leaf area index,<br/>harvest index (HI), yield and WUE were not significantly affected by<br/>interaction between irrigation and mulching treatments. All mulching<br/>materials effectively reduced salt accumulation in the root zone.<br/>Mulching treatments markedly increased WUE and yield in the order of<br/>FYM> RSM> PM> WM Results showed that, irrigation ofsquash with<br/>85 . the I8j strategy studied here could be succe~sfully applied during<br/>summer and fall seasons in commercial squash production allowing<br/>water savings of 15% without any detrimental effect on plant growth or<br/>yield.
